Vitreoretinal surgery fellowships vary significantly in structure, offering different levels of autonomy and supervision for trainees.
-
2
Identifying one's learning style is crucial for prospective retina fellows to choose a program that aligns with their educational needs.
-
3
Mentorship plays a vital role in the success of retina fellows, impacting both clinical skills and professional development.
-
4
Fellowship locations are important for personal support systems and networking opportunities with future employers.
-
5
As of 2025, some fellowship programs may require noncompete clauses, which candidates should investigate before committing.
